The Danish challenges
• The industry is experiencing yearly growth rates at 25-30 percent.
• The industry needs more than 150 new engineers in Denmark every year.
• Decreasing interest in engineering among young Danes and existing engineer students have limited knowledge about wind power.
• The industry in Denmark is faced with an fierce competition to recruit young engineers
• This led to new ideas to approach the students and new ways to show responsibility towards educating the next generation of engineers in the wind power industry.

Results so far
• More than 35 project proposals available
• More than 10 traineeships available
• Approx. 100 CV’s in the database
• Approx. 100 applications for the Wind Power Tour 2007
• A strong ambassador network among educators at the engineering educations
Learning points
• Difficult to reach students and educators because of fierce competition from other businesses
• Difficult to change the mentality in the companies and making them proactive towards students
• Advantage that it’s entire industry that’s behind the initiative
